在当今数字经济快速发展的时代,区块链技术作为一种颠覆传统行业的创新手段,正受到越来越多的关注。其技术底层的稳定性,不仅支撑了比特币、以太坊等加密货币的运作,还在金融、供应链、医疗等多个领域展现了巨大的潜力和应用价值。本文将深度分析区块链技术为何保持稳定,并探讨相关的几个关键问题。
区块链是一种分布式的数据库技术,其最核心的特点在于去中心化和不可篡改。每个区块中记录了一定数量的交易信息,这些区块通过加密算法连接在一起,形成链式结构。这种结构保证了数据的透明性和安全性,阻止了任何个体专项对数据进行修改或删除。
区块链的稳定性主要源于其底层的技术设计,包括共识机制、加密算法和网络结构。下面我们将进一步探讨这几个关键因素对区块链稳定性的影响。
共识机制是区块链中各个节点达成一致的规则,在去中心化的网络中扮演着至关重要的角色。目前,主流的共识机制有工作量证明(PoW)、权益证明(PoS)、拜占庭容错机制(BFT)等。
例如,在比特币网络中,工作量证明机制要求节点(矿工)通过计算复杂的数学题来获得记账权,这一过程消耗了大量的计算资源和时间。然而,这种机制的稳定性体现在两个方面:首先,攻击者需要拥有超过50%的计算能力才能对网络进行攻击,这几乎不可能;其次,矿工们的竞争性使得网络不断得到维护和更新,从而确保了其稳定运行。
而在以太坊中,权益证明机制则通过持有代币数量来判断节点的记账权,持有越多的代币,获得记账权的概率就越高。这一机制降低了计算能力的需求,有助于降低能源消耗,增强系统的可扩展性,同时具备一定的安全性。
综上所述,共识机制的设计直接关系到区块链网络的稳定性和安全性。有效的共识机制不仅能确保数据的真实性,还能防止潜在的恶意攻击。
区块链网络采用的是分布式存储的方式,即数据不存放在单一的中心服务器上,而是分散存储在网络中的多个节点上。这一结构使得整个系统的稳定性大幅提升,因为即使部分节点失效,网络整体仍然可以正常运作。
区块链的去中心化特点确保了数据的可靠性和安全性。每个节点都保存着完整的区块链账本,任何节点都可以验证交易的有效性。这种设计使得网络更具抗击攻击的能力,比如在遭遇DDoS攻击时,其他健康节点依然可以维持系统的正常运行。
此外,区块链还通过数据冗余来提升稳定性。当某个节点出现故障时,其他节点能够弥补其缺失的数据,保持整个网络的连贯性。这种存储方式使得区块链网络在应对不确定性和故障时表现出优异的稳定性。
区块链的另一大核心特征是使用了各种加密技术来保护数据,从而增强了其安全性和隐私性。每个区块通过哈希函数与前一个区块相连接,这保证了区块的不可篡改。一旦数据被记录在区块链上,无论是历史交易还是智能合约,任何人都不能随意修改这些数据。
此外,区块链中的数字签名技术确保了交易的真实性。每个交易都需要通过私钥进行签名,只有拥有该私钥的人才能执行交易。这种机制使得假冒和欺诈行为大大降低,确保了用户之间的信任。
同时,区块链技术还可以通过智能合约提升系统的自动化水平,减少人为干预的必要性。智能合约是在区块链上执行的一段代码,可以实现自动化的决策和操作,从而进一步增强了整个系统的稳定性。
尽管区块链在稳定性上展现出了诸多优势,但仍面临一些挑战,例如扩展性、隐私保护等问题。随着越来越多的用户和应用接入,如何保持区块链的高速性能成为一个重要议题。
此外,法律和政策的不确定性也可能影响区块链的应用与发展。各国对加密货币和区块链的监管态度不同,可能导致行业的不稳定发展。
为解决这些问题,区块链技术正在不断进化,许多新的共识机制和技术解决方案应运而生。未来的区块链将具备更强的弹性和适应性,继续在全球经济发展中发挥关键作用。
去中心化是区块链技术的核心特征之一,它的实现依赖于分布式网络和各类共识机制。为了理解这一概念,我们需要探讨以下几点:
首先,去中心化意味着没有单一的控制点。在传统的中心化系统中,数据由单个实体维护和管理,而在区块链中,所有参与者都拥有该网络的副本,这确保了数据的共享和透明。即使某个节点被关闭,整个系统依然可以正常运作。
其次,区块链通过共识机制来确保网络中的所有节点对交易的有效性达成一致。每当有新的交易被发起时,网络中的节点会共同验证交易,并通过一种特定的算法(例如PoW或PoS)对其进行确认。这一过程消除了个体对中心化决策的依赖,增强了去中心化的可靠性。
最后,区块链的去中心化还体现在其参与者之间的平权关系。所有节点无论其经济实力如何,都具有相同的权利和责任,这种平等性为区块链网络的稳定性奠定了基础。
区块链能够保证数据不可篡改的关键在于其哈希算法和数据结构设计。具体而言,数据的不可篡改主要体现在以下几个方面:
首先,区块与区块之间的连接是通过哈希函数实现的。每个区块都包含了前一区块的哈希值,这样,即使是对某个区块中的单一数据进行修改,后续所有区块的哈希值也会随之改变。这种特性使得篡改数据的成本极高,几乎不可能执行。
其次,区块链中的每笔交易都需要经过全网节点的验证,只有在达成共识后才能被记录。因此,任何一方想要篡改数据,不仅需要控制该区块,还需要对后续所有区块进行重新计算,同时也需要获得超过50%的算力,成本极高。
最后,区块链的透明性使得所有数据可以由参与者随时验证。用户可以随时查阅区块链上的交易记录,任何不正常的变更都可以被及时发现。由于这种开放性,区块链的可追溯性增强了其数据不可篡改的特性。
扩展性是区块链技术面临的主要挑战之一,尤其是在用户和事务量快速增长的情况下,如何保持网络的速度和效率至关重要。针对这一问题,有以下几种解决方案:
首先,开发者可以实现分片技术,将区块链网络分割成多个小块,各个小块独立处理事务。这样可以显著提高整体效率,因为每个分片都可以并行处理,而不会造成系统的瓶颈。
其次,二层解决方案(Layer 2 solutions)也被广泛应用。例如,闪电网络(Lightning Network)通过在主链外处理小额交易,仅在必要时与主链进行交互,这样可以减少主链上的事务数量,从而提升其整体处理能力。
最后,跨链技术(Cross-chain technology)也在不断发展,允许不同区块链之间进行数据和资产的交互,从而避免某一链的处理瓶颈,更加灵活地应对不断增长的用户需求。
随着技术的不断演进,区块链在各行各业的应用前景广阔。具体来说,未来可能会出现以下几种应用趋势:
首先,金融行业将持续是区块链技术应用的重心。去中心化金融(DeFi)的兴起使得传统金融模式面临挑战,区块链将系统整合各种金融服务,提供更高效率和透明度的支付及清结算方式。
其次,在供应链管理中,区块链可以提高透明度和追踪能力,帮助企业简化流程,并确保产品质量。产品的源头和运输过程均可以被记录和验证,减少了假货的风险。
最后,在医疗健康领域,基于区块链技术的电子健康记录将使得患者的医疗数据安全且可追踪,不同医疗机构间的信息共享将变得更加高效、安全。
综上所述,区块链技术的应用与发展远未结束,随着各方的协同努力,区块链未来将会在更多领域开花结果。
2003-2025 TP官方网址下载 @版权所有|网站地图|蜀ICP备20022272号